Output e73358e553262b3aaf5e3c71e592f7dc1c909cab4a5a98d9c8af09c99e4ef9ab:7

value
50000056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b74ddeef1cb122eb3eddc2bb86c4dffe7e69806 OP_EQUAL
address
3QcbXkS59h3e8JfJYuu3wjDNhgDnTKxxjc
transaction
e73358e553262b3aaf5e3c71e592f7dc1c909cab4a5a98d9c8af09c99e4ef9ab
confirmations
284747
spent
true